RADIATION THERAPY PLAYS IMPORTANT ROLE
UCLA Radiation Oncologist Dr. Ann Raldow, a member of the UCLA Health's
transplant-tolerance team, explains, “The patients come in before their transplant
and we develop a radiation-therapy plan that is specific to their anatomy,” taking
special care to avoid exposing the newly transplanted kidney to radiation.
